So I setup my own DIY ATO with my Neptune controller. I installed one of their optical eye sensors to detect the water level. And thankfully, I installed a float switch for the high water. Well in the 3 days I've had it up and running here is my experience.
Day 1 - come home from work and the water is about an 1inch below the sensor. Yet Apex doesn't detect it and never turned on my ATO. Played around with it, disconnected everything, plugged it back in and everything looked like it was working.
Day 2 - come home and same thing. Sensor never detected the water was below and never activated my ATO. Unplugged everything again, and seemed to be working fine again.
Day 3 - Come home and again water is below the sensor. Did all the same again, and seemed to be working. I come back an hour later to see my water really cloudy. Yea, glad I checked when I did, b/c it filled up to my emergency float and pumped about 2 gallons of KALK into my tank. It never detected the water line was ABOVE, and never shut off.
So 3 days into this, and it hasn't worked once yet. Not to mention my leak detectors I got also have been very finicky.
Has anyone had these problems as well? I'm wondering if my FMM module is bad? I'm so unplugging my kalk reactor until this gets figure out, or finds its way into the garbage can :-(.
